#e13674 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#e13674 is composed of 88.2% red, 21.2%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 76% magenta, 48.4%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 338.2 degrees, a saturation of 74% and a lightness of 54.7%. #e13674 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6ce8 with #c30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

● #e13674 color description : Bright pink.
The hexadecimal color #e13674 has RGB values of R:225, G:54,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.76, Y:0.48,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14759540.
